I was led to believe that the US does have internal sources of these, but they are largely undeveloped. For years the processing could not economically compete with China so shutdown.

Which is to say, given internal subsidies, the US could eventually produce some on its own.

Unless I misunderstood the situation.


I believe we both share this understanding, the problems are

1. China controls ~90% today

2. The US will find it difficult to build out because of how dirty and environmentally damaging mining and processing are.

I did see some research last week about a better way to process rare earths, but it is still research and will need to be industrialized.

Regardless, it will take many years (decade+?) to become self sufficient and China is already willing to and increasingly restricting them
